The National Hospital Mutual Fund (MNH), which has more than one million members, was the victim of a cyberattack, the mutual based in Amilly (Loiret) announced on Friday.
“
We are not able to say if there has been a data breach.
As there was a very rapid disconnection, we hope for a slight data leak
, ”explained a spokesperson for the MNH, adding that 800,000 files were potentially affected.

“
We detected an intrusion on Friday 5 February.
We disconnected quickly.
IT teams attempt to recover the system and isolate the malware.
We cannot turn the PCs back on until further notice,
”the MNH spokesperson told AFP.
Refunds are therefore delayed, according to the MNH, which employs more than 700 employees.
The mutual, whose website is also unusable, claims to have lodged a complaint.
At the beginning of the week, the hospital center of Dax (Landes) was hit by a cyber attack "
by ransomware
" which paralyzed its computer system.
